Forward Testing and Early Lessons
Over the past week, I’ve been forward testing my betting strategy, which had scored 17/21 in the historical database. In live conditions, though, it’s off to a rough start: just 2 wins out of 6, failing to match the accuracy seen during development.
The good news, though, is that after an initial 4-loss streak, the last two games bounced back with wins. I might have lost heart and abandoned the strategy entirely if not for my consultations with GPT, which helped me step back and see the bigger picture.
For now, it’s still far too early to draw conclusions. Six games don’t make a meaningful sample. The real test will be the next 50. That’s when the numbers will tell me whether this strategy holds a genuine edge—or just captured noise in the past data.
